Asia named as growth catalyst
Asia-Pacific will drive demand for air travel over the next 2 decades, according to the 2018 Air Travel Outlook report produced by Expedia in collaboration with the Airlines Reporting Corporation. Based on the IATA 20-year air passenger forecast, air travel routes to, from and within Asia-Pacific will see an extra 2.1b annual passengers by 2036 -- an average growth rate of 4.6%. China is expected to displace the US as the world's largest aviation market by 2022, while India will overtake Britain, currently ranked fifth, by 2025, with Indonesia catching up by 2030. Thailand is anticipated to enter the world's top 10 largest aviation markets during the forecast period. <br/>
